The Red Bank Fire burning west of Red Bluff has now burned 6,500 acres and is 5 percent contained.
The blaze started Thursday afternoon off of Hammer Loop Road and Petty John Road.
There are evacuation orders for Petty John Road to the Forest Service Boundary and for Red Bank Oaks Subdivision, and R-Wild Horse Ranch.
According to Cal Fire, the blaze is burning in a remote location with difficult access.
